Abstract:We give a detailed description of the geometry of isotropic space, in parallel to those of Euclidean space within the realm of Laguerre geometry. After developing basic surface theory in isotropic space, we define spin transformations, directly leading to the spinor representation of conformal surfaces in isotropic space.
